[swift-evolution] [Proposal] Normalize Unicode Identifiers

João Pinheiro joao at joaopinheiro.org
Tue Jul 26 17:30:51 CDT 2016


I'll wait until next week to ping about this again when the stress from Swift 3 has passed. I'll also revise the proposal to clarify about the small code-breaking possibility. As Xiaodi Wu mentioned, this change is highly unlikely to be code-breaking and existing code that would be broken up by this normalisation could arguably be considered broken already.

Sincerely,
João Pinheiro


> On 26 Jul 2016, at 22:32, Chris Lattner <clattner at apple.com> wrote:
> 
> 
>> On Jul 26, 2016, at 12:22 PM, João Pinheiro via swift-evolution <swift-evolution at swift.org <mailto:swift-evolution at swift.org>> wrote:
>> 
>> This proposal [gist <https://gist.github.com/JoaoPinheiro/5f226f46c67d235a7039c775a4300800>] is the result of the discussions from the thread "Prohibit invisible characters in identifier names <http://thread.gmane.org/gmane.comp.lang.swift.evolution/21022>". I hope it's still on time for inclusion in Swift 3.
> 
> Hi João,
> 
> Unfortunately, we’re out of time to accept new proposals.  Tomorrow is the last day for *implementation* work on source breaking changes to be done.  We can talk about this next week for Swift 3.x or Swift 4.
> 
> -Chris

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.swift.org/pipermail/swift-evolution/attachments/20160727/81cb8762/attachment.html>


More information about the swift-evolution mailing list